Nedumbassery is a vibrant city located in the state of Kerala, India. Situated near the city of Kochi, Nedumbassery serves as the home of Cochin International Airport, one of the busiest airports in the country. This bustling city attracts travelers, businesspeople, and tourists alike, making it an important hub in the region.
Nedumbassery, located in Kerala, India, is a city that offers a unique blend of natural beauty and modern amenities. The highlight of this city is undoubtedly the Cochin International Airport, which has earned international acclaim for its innovative design and eco-friendly initiatives. Serving as a major gateway to Kerala and the southern parts of India, the airport has put Nedumbassery on the global map. Tourist Attractions
Cochin International Airport: The largest and busiest airport in Kerala, serving as the gateway to Nedumbassery and the state.
Athirapally Waterfalls: A spectacular cascade surrounded by lush greenery, offering a mesmerizing experience for nature lovers.
Nedumbassery Sree Krishna Temple: A famous Hindu temple known for its architectural beauty and religious significance.
Cherai Beach: A pristine beach with golden sands and clear waters, perfect for relaxing and enjoying various water sports.
Thattekkad Bird Sanctuary: A haven for birdwatchers, housing a diverse range of avian species in its dense forests and wetlands.
Hill Palace Museum: A museum showcasing the rich heritage and artifacts of the erstwhile Maharajas of Kochi, open for public viewing.
Vallarpadam Church: A historic church dedicated to the Virgin Mary, known for its stunning architecture and religious significance.
Kodanad Elephant Training Center: A unique center where elephants are trained and cared for, offering visitors an opportunity to interact with these majestic creatures.
Kanjiramattom Mosque: A prominent Muslim shrine known for its annual religious festival that attracts devotees from different parts of Kerala.
Museum of Kerala History: A museum showcasing the history, culture, and heritage of Kerala through carefully curated exhibits and artifacts.
